One of the main advantages of a hard tent is its ease of setup. Unlike traditional tents that require time and effort to pitch, hard tents are typically mounted on top of your vehicle and can be set up in a matter of minutes. This is especially convenient if you are setting up camp in a remote or rugged location where finding a flat and dry spot to pitch a traditional tent can be a challenge. With a hard tent, all you need to do is pull up to your campsite, unfold the tent, and you are ready to relax and unwind.
Another advantage of a hard tent is its durability and weather resistance. hard tents are made from sturdy materials that can withstand the elements, including wind, rain, and even snow. This means that you can camp comfortably in any weather conditions without having to worry about your tent collapsing or leaking. The hard shell of the tent also provides added protection from wildlife and insects, giving you peace of mind while you sleep.
hard tents also offer a higher vantage point compared to traditional ground tents, providing better views and ventilation. Being elevated off the ground can also help keep you safe from critters and other unwanted visitors that may wander into your campsite during the night. Additionally, the built-in mattress that comes with most hard tents provides a comfortable sleeping arrangement that can rival the comforts of home.
One of the biggest advantages of a hard tent is its versatility. Whether you are camping in the mountains, the desert, or even on a beach, a hard tent can provide a comfortable and secure sleeping space wherever your adventures take you. The compact size of a hard tent also makes it easy to store and transport, making it ideal for road trips and camping expeditions.
For those who enjoy off-grid camping or overlanding, a hard tent is the perfect option. Its rugged construction and ability to be mounted on a vehicle make it well-suited for extended trips into remote areas where traditional camping facilities may be scarce. Additionally, many hard tents come equipped with additional features such as integrated lighting, storage pockets, and even annex rooms that can enhance your camping experience.
